High-Level Overview
Anima App is an AI-powered design-to-code platform that transforms Figma designs, text prompts, or images into production-ready web applications with pixel-perfect accuracy. It serves designers, developers, and product teams by enabling rapid prototyping, seamless collaboration, and direct export of code in HTML, React, Vue, and CSS frameworks like Tailwind or Styled Components. By bridging the gap between creative design and functional code, Anima accelerates the development lifecycle, reduces handoff friction, and helps teams maintain brand consistency and design fidelity throughout the build process[1][4].
The platform targets startups, design agencies, and enterprises looking to streamline UI development and improve cross-functional workflows. It solves the problem of manual, error-prone translation from static designs to code, enabling faster iteration and deployment of websites, web apps, and prototypes. Anima’s growth momentum is evidenced by its adoption as a leading Figma plugin and integration with modern developer tools like GitHub and Bolt IDE, positioning it as a key enabler in the no-code/low-code and AI-assisted development trend[1][4].

Core Differentiators
- AI-Powered Design-to-Code Conversion: Anima uses advanced AI to interpret design elements and generate pixel-perfect, production-ready code in multiple frameworks (React, Vue, HTML/CSS, Tailwind, Styled Components)[1][4].
- Multi-Tool Integration: Works seamlessly with popular design tools like Figma, Sketch, and Adobe XD, allowing designers to stay in their preferred environment while producing developer-ready outputs[2][4].
- Interactive Prototyping: Supports complex animations, hover states, responsive breakpoints, and interactions directly from design files, which are preserved in the exported code[2].
- Developer-Friendly Output: Provides clean, customizable code with options to export to GitHub or download locally, facilitating easy integration into existing development workflows[3][4].
- AI-Driven Iteration and Customization: Features an AI chat-powered playground for natural language prompts to tweak designs and code, enabling rapid iteration without deep coding knowledge[4].
- One-Click Deployment: Enables direct publishing of websites or apps from the platform, accelerating time to market[1][4].
